On Fri, Jun 13, 2025 at 11:52:06PM +0300, Vladimir Oltean wrote:
> On Thu, Jun 12, 2025 at 11:36:12PM -0400, Hyunwoo Kim wrote:
> > On Thu, Jun 12, 2025 at 01:23:38PM -0700, Cong Wang wrote:
> > > On Thu, Jun 12, 2025 at 07:16:55AM -0400, Hyunwoo Kim wrote:
> > > > diff --git a/net/sched/sch_taprio.c b/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> > > index 14021b812329..bd2b02d1dc63 100644
> > > > --- a/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> > > +++ b/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> > > @@ -1320,6 +1320,7 @@ static int taprio_dev_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long event,
> > > > if (event != NETDEV_UP && event != NETDEV_CHANGE)
> > > > return NOTIFY_DONE;
> > > >
> > > > + rcu_read_lock();
> > > > list_for_each_entry(q, &taprio_list, taprio_list) {
> > > > if (dev != qdisc_dev(q->root))
> > > > continue;
> > > > @@ -1328,16 +1329,17 @@ static int taprio_dev_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long event,
> > >
> > > There is a taprio_set_picos_per_byte() call here, it calls
> > > __ethtool_get_link_ksettings() which could be blocking.
> > >
> > > For instance, gve_get_link_ksettings() calls
> > > gve_adminq_report_link_speed() which is a blocking function.
> > >
> > > So I am afraid we can't enforce an atomic context here.
> >
> > In that case, how about moving the lock as follows so that
> > taprio_set_picos_per_byte() isn’t included within it?
> >
> > ```
> > diff --git a/net/sched/sch_taprio.c b/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> index 14021b812329..2b14c81a87e5 100644
> > --- a/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> +++ b/net/sched/sch_taprio.c
> > @@ -1328,13 +1328,15 @@ static int taprio_dev_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long event,
> >
> > stab = rtnl_dereference(q->root->stab);
> >
> > - oper = rtnl_dereference(q->oper_sched);
> > + rcu_read_lock();
> > + oper = rcu_dereference(q->oper_sched);
> > if (oper)
> > taprio_update_queue_max_sdu(q, oper, stab);
> >
> > - admin = rtnl_dereference(q->admin_sched);
> > + admin = rcu_dereference(q->admin_sched);
> > if (admin)
> > taprio_update_queue_max_sdu(q, admin, stab);
> > + rcu_read_unlock();
> >
> > break;
> > }
> > ```
> >
> > This change still prevents the race condition with advance_sched().
>
> This should work.
OK, I’ll submit the v3 patch.
>
> And I'm sorry for the bug introduced here, and elsewhere, by assuming
> rtnl_dereference() will be fine.
> I mostly use taprio with offload, where switch_schedules() runs in
> process context with rtnl_lock() held, not the software emulation that
> changes the schedules from the advance_sched() hrtimer. Somehow the
> different locking requirements for the 2 cases eluded me.
